Full job description

As a Hardware Automation Engineer, you will play a crucial role in defining the future of flexible manufacturing testing. In this position, you'll be responsible for developing and implementing automated testing solutions for millions of possible product permutations, collaborating with cross-functional teams to ensure 100% test coverage across custom hardware, unique BIOS settings, and specialized system images. Your efforts directly impact our ability to deliver perfectly tailored, highly reliable computing systems to our customers, helping us raise the industry bar by solving complex automation challenges where no two products are exactly alike.

We believe in the power of in-person collaboration and the benefits of a strong workplace community. Therefore, this role requires an onsite presence at our South Burlington, VT office. We encourage candidates who are able to relocate or comfortably commute to apply.

In this role, you’ll be responsible for:

  • Engaging with Design, Validation, and Applications Engineers to understand what functionality is expected from any given component and creating an appropriate test plan.

  • Writing the needed test code and implementing it in the automation framework.

  • Streamlining the New Product Introduction process by collaborating with Validation Engineers to ensure tests being used in the development process are also suitable for use in production.

  • Ensuring adequate production test capabilities are ready in time for the release of all systems.

  • Deeply understanding designs to evaluate tests, remedy test failures, and provide quick feedback to improve performance.

  • Helping meet production goals related to takt time by right-sizing test coverage, leveraging test parallelism, and advocating for shifting functional testing upstream to vendors, ODMs, and CMs.

  • Taking ownership of the tests and platform in our brand-new automated test framework.

  • Documenting your work.

  • Providing feedback to the design team so they know how to make the products we design more testable (DfM/DfT).

Requirements

  • 5 years of experience in a production test environment is required.

  • Love of hardware. Even though you’ll be living in software, it’s all for the success of the hardware, so you need to understand it and enjoy being hands-on.

  • Understanding of and experience with software frameworks and scripting languages, preferably Bash and Python.

  • Knowledge of lower-level Linux conventions and standard Linux tooling.

  • Experience in a production test environment is required.

  • Deep understanding of distributed systems, microservices, and standard communication protocols between them.

  • Bachelor’s Degree or comparable experience in Computer Science, Computer Engineering, or a related field.

  • Ability to work in the U.S. without visa sponsorship.
